Ingredients:
serving: 5 waffles(60g/2.1oz), 1 waffle(40g/1.4oz)
1 cup(175g/6.17oz)Mochiko(Koda Farm)
1 + 1/2 tbsp of melted butter(unsalted)
1 tbsp of sugar
1/4 tsp of salt
1/2 tsp of vanilla extract
1 egg
85ml of whole milk
📌 Cooking Notes
Mochi Waffles can be frozen and reheated. 350F for 7-8 minutes in the oven
*Update Info: If you use glutinous rice flour instead of mochiko, the batter will be much looser, similar to regular pancake batter. Skip the step of shaping the dough into balls and simply pour the batter into a waffle maker. It tastes just as great as when using mochiko!
